May is National Mental Health Awareness Month, an annual observance established in 1949 to reduce stigma, educate the public, and support those living with mental health conditions.

Led by organizations such as NAMI, this month features community events, advocacy initiatives, and shared resources dedicated to promoting mental wellness. Exercise combats health conditions and diseases

Exercise combats health conditions and diseases.

Worried about heart disease? Hoping to prevent high blood pressure? No matter what your current weight is, being active boosts high-density lipoprotein (HDL) cholesterol, the "good" cholesterol, and it decreases unhealthy triglycerides. This one-two punch keeps your blood flowing smoothly, which lowers your risk of heart and blood vessel, called cardiovascular, diseases.

Regular exercise helps prevent or manage many health problems and concerns, including:

Stroke.

Metabolic syndrome.

High blood pressure.

Type 2 diabetes.

Depression.

Anxiety.

Many types of cancer.

Arthritis.

Falls.

It also can help improve cognitive function and helps lower the risk of death from all causes.

Stress is something everyone experiences, often many times throughout the day. With today's political climate, mental stress is at an all-time high for many. Mental health is just as important as physical health. Good mental health can help you cope with the challenges of daily life, maintain healthy relationships, and achieve your goals. However, poor mental health can lead to various problems, including anxiety, depression, substance abuse, and even su***de.

Stress is one of the leading causes of poor mental health. When stressed, your body releases hormones like cortisol and adrenaline that trigger the “fight or flight” response. This response can be helpful in dangerous situations, but chronic stress can lead to a range of health problems, including anxiety, depression, insomnia, and digestive issues.
